在话费快充接口对接过程中,可能会遇到一些常见问题,以下是一些问题及其可能的解决方案:
1.认证问题: 无法成功进行身份验证或认证失败。
-解决方案: 确保提供了正确的认证信息,如访问令牌或API密钥。检查认证方法和头部是否正确。
2.请求格式错误: 请求参数格式不正确,导致请求无法被服务器解析。
-解决方案: 仔细阅读API文档,检查请求参数的名称、类型和格式。使用适当的HTTP请求方法。
3.响应解析问题: 无法正确解析服务器返回的响应,导致无法获取所需的数据。
-解决方案: 检查响应的数据格式,确保你的解析代码与响应格式相匹配。使用合适的解析库。
4.超时问题: 请求花费的时间过长,导致超时或连接中断。
-解决方案: 设置适当的请求超时时间,确保网络连接稳定。可以考虑设置超时后自动重试。
5.服务器错误: 服务器返回5xx错误,表示服务器内部出现问题。
-解决方案: 此类问题通常不在你的控制范围内,可以等待一段时间后重新尝试,或联系提供商的技术支持。
6.错误响应: 服务器返回错误响应,但错误信息不清楚。
-解决方案: 查阅API文档,了解可能的错误代码和描述。如果仍不清楚,可以联系提供商的支持。
7.频率限制或配额问题: 请求频率超出了API的限制或配额。
-解决方案: 确认API提供商的配额限制,合理控制请求频率。可以考虑实施请求队列或限速策略。
8.安全问题: 出现安全问题,如未经授权的访问尝试。
-解决方案: 确保已经实施了适当的身份验证和授权机制,以防止未经授权的访问。
9.版本兼容性问题: 服务器版本更新后,原有的请求不再兼容。
-解决方案: 定期检查API文档和更新,确保你的请求和代码与最新版本保持兼容。
10.网络问题: 可能由于网络问题,无法与API服务器建立连接。
-解决方案: 确保你的网络连接稳定,可以尝试使用其他网络或调整网络设置。
在对接过程中,注意及时查阅API文档、调试日志和错误信息,以便更好地解决问题。如果问题无法解决,不要犹豫联系提供商的技术支持,寻求帮助。